The point group symmetry of a molecule is defined by the presence or absence of 5 types of symmetry element.. Symmetry axis: an axis around which a rotation by results in a molecule indistinguishable from the original. This is also called an n-fold rotational axis and abbreviated C n.Examples are the C 2 axis in water and the C 3 axis in ammonia.A …

In particular, for each n2N, the symmetric group S n is the group of per-mutations of the set f1;:::;ng, with the group … WebAutomorphism of a set is an arbitrary permutation of its elements. An automorphism of a group is permutation of its elements which preserves the operation, i.e. φ ( x y) = φ ( x) φ ( y). Since every group G is a set, you can look at two possible automorphism groups: one - Aut S e t ( G) as a set and the other Aut G p ( G) as a group.
